A controlled study of aripiprazole and risperidone in treatment of schizophrenia

Abstract

Objective To compare the efficacy and safety of aripiprazole and risperidone in the treatment of schizophrenia.Methods 60 patients with schizophrenia were randomly divided into two groups: aripiprazole group(n=30) and risperidone group(n=30).The therapeutic effects were evaluated by PANSS,and side effects were assessed by TESS before and after 2,4,6 and 8 treatment weeks.Results The rates of marked improvement in aripiprazole group and risperidone group were 76.7% and 73.3%,respectively.Conclusion Both aripiprazole and risperidone have good effective in the treatment of schizophrenia.But aripiprazole has less adverse effects.It's an effective and safe antipsychotic drug.
